信息加密技术是指将明文信息经过一定的算法转化成密文,以保护信息的安全性并确保只有授权的人能够阅读信息。信息加密技术是计算机和互联网应用的重要技术之一,其分类可以从不同角度进行。
一、对称密码和非对称密码
根据密钥是否相同,信息加密技术可以分为对称密码和非对称密码两种方式。对称密码使用相同的密钥加密和解密信息,加密和解密速度快,但是密钥的安全问题容易受到威胁。非对称密码则采用公钥和私钥相结合的方式,加密使用公钥,解密使用私钥,是目前最流行的加密方式之一。
二、单向哈希函数
单向哈希函数是一种从明文到密文的函数,这种函数无法反向计算出原始的明文信息。单向哈希函数主要用于数字签名、密码保护、数据完整性验证、等场合。
三、数字签名技术
数字签名技术利用非对称加密算法实现对电子文件的签名,可以保证文件的完整性和认证性。数字签名技术也是目前互联网应用中广泛采用的一种技术。
四、公钥基础设施(PKI)
公钥基础设施是一组相互依存的技术,其基本原则是通过多种技术手段实现对公钥和私钥的管理和认证。PKI技术主要用于证书认证、数字签名等场景。
五、文件加密
文件加密通常是使用对称加密算法实现的,可以将文件中敏感信息进行加密后再保存到磁盘上,以此来保证文件的隐私性。
综上所述,信息加密技术有对称密码和非对称密码、单向哈希函数、数字签名技术、公钥基础设施、文件加密等多种方式,每一种方式都有其独特的作用和优缺点。在使用信息加密技术的同时,需要注意密钥的安全保护、算法的选择、加密和解密效率等问题,以此最大程度地保障信息的安全性。
扫码咨询 领取资料